2017-08-22 7 views
2

div内に画像を追加しています。私はその画像上でユーザが右クリックしたところで、画像の座標を取得したい(画面の座標ではない)。どうやってやるの?jqueryまたはjavascriptを使用して画像の座標を取得する

<div id="Boma" style="width: 1000px; height: 600px; position: relative"> 
    <img src="Boma_1_2/F16_20170316141116392_0001.jpg" alt="Boma" style="width: 1000px; height: 600px;"> 
</div> 
+1

http://jsbin.com/akiwo – Baptiste

+0

ヘルプページ、特に[ここではどのトピックについて聞くことができますか?](http://stackoverflow.com/help/)のセクションを読んでください。 on-topic)と[[どのような種類の質問を避けるべきですか?]](http://stackoverflow.com/help/dont-ask)を参照してください。さらに重要なことは、[Stack Overflow question checklist](http://meta.stackexchange.com/q/156810/204922)をお読みください。また、[最小、完全、および検証可能な例](http://stackoverflow.com/help/mcve)についても知りたいことがあります。 –

答えて

0

私は.offset() jQueryの機能をチェックアウトすることをお勧めいたします:

.offset()メソッドは、私たちは、要素(マージンを除く、具体的にその境界ボックス)の現在位置を取得することができます文書を基準にしています。

HereJavascriptをで右クリックを使用する方法についてかなり明確かつ便利コメントです。

これで、やりたいことを作成するためのツールがすべて用意されているはずです。それが助けてくれることを願って。

関連する問題